Job Description

We currently have a fantastic Fixed Term contract opportunity for a proactive and organised Team Administrator to support our hard working and fun Group Legal team on a part time basis (3- 4 days per week).

Despite the current circumstances we are still recruiting for roles. In compliance with UK Government advice relating to COVID-19 this role will be remotely based in line with our current workforce and we will supply you with the tools and technologies to enable you to do so. Similarly all interviews will be conducted by google hangouts or equivalent video conferring technologies.

What you'll be doing

This diverse role will keep you busy and engaged. From booking meetings, organising training to updating the intranet pages you will have plenty of responsibility from day one.

Other key duties will include:

  • Acting as a “super-user” for the team's document management system, including hard and soft copy legal document filing,
  • Managing the team's diary/activities/events, supporting meetings and events by ensuring that arrangements are in place for all resources and materials to be booked and available on the day and that appropriate records are kept.
  • Supporting the Principal Legal Counsel and Head of Group Legal and working closely with the members of Group Legal so the department runs efficiently and cohesively and all administration needs are met.

In addition to BAU activities you'll also provide valuable support to a contract management project that is due to kick off in the new year.

This is the ideal opportunity for an enthusiastic administrator that's also keen to gain further knowledge of the legal sector, so there will be scope to provide administrative support with trademark and IP management and team data protection requirements.


 

What we're looking for:

You'll be able to demonstrate excellent admin, organisation and planning skills. Beyond this, we're looking for someone who will build genuine working relationships across the team, take ownership and become an indispensable team member.


 

If you have experience supporting or working as part of a legal team previously that would also be highly advantageous.
